Cambrian Homes – Market Report

Week ending December 3, 2011 compared to December 4, 2010

There were 92 Cambrian homes, including short sales and bank owned homes in the week ending December 3, 2011.

There were 147 Cambrian homes, including short sales and bank owned homes in week ending December 4, 2010.

Of the 92 Cambrian homes there were 19 San Jose short sales, 11 bank owned homes and 62 traditional Cambrian homes for sale.

Cambrian Real Estate – November 2011 Market Report

  • Median Price: $579,500 = 5.0% increase from October 2011 ($552,000)
  • Average Price: $613,950 = 7.9% increase from October 2011 ($569,068)
  • No. of Sales: 42 = 13.5% increase from October 2011 (37 sales)
  • Sale vs. List Price: 98.2% = 0.4% increase from October 2011 (97.8%)
  • Days on Market: 52 = 27.3% decrease from October 2011 (71 days)

Cambrian Home prices were up in November. Year over year the median price of a Cambrian home was $600,000, down 3.4%.  However year over year the average price of a Cambrian home is the same. Inventory continues to decrease which is driving prices up.
